Family Education offered at Somali Community Services of Seattle

8810 Renton Avenue South, Seattle, WA 98118

Located near the intersection of S Henderson St and Renton Ave S. Call King County Metro at (206) 553-3000 or visit http://tripplanner.kingcounty.gov/ for public transit information.
Eligibility
Primarily refugees and immigrants.
Hours
9am to 5pm from Monday through Friday and 11am to 3pm on Saturdays
Application process
Call or visit in person. Services provided by appointment.
Fees
None.
Service area
King, WA

Other Information

Payment Options

  • Free

Languages

  • Somali
  • Oromo
Provides parenting education classes, family conflict intervention and mediation, focusing on cultural transition issues. Provides transportation by appointment with a community van.
